Did you put anything in the gas tank to preserve the gas? If not, it won't be good after two years. I doubt the engine will run. The fuel pump may be bad and the tank may need to be removed and cleaned out.
I'd also unplug the main relay and crank it over for about 5 seconds (repeat that several times, waiting a minute or so between crankings to avoid overheating the starter) to make sure everything is covered in oil before it fires. Look closely at the tires too, they may not be safe after sitting for 2 years. The brakes will probably sound terrible the first few times you hit them until the corrosion is cleaned off. Other than all that, just drive it gently for at least a few miles before pushing it.
